Review summary

Created with AI, based on recent reviews

Considering 26 reviews, most reviewers were somewhat happy with their experience overall. Many consumers praise the earplugs for effectively blocking noise, especially snoring, and appreciate their comfort for extended wear. People with smaller ear canals often find these earplugs fit well and stay in place, providing a good night's sleep. The product's durability and longevity are also frequently highlighted. However, some people were dissatisfied with the product's fit and comfort, reporting issues like the earplugs falling out, causing pain, or being difficult to insert or remove. A portion of customers also experienced negative interactions with customer service, citing poor communication or unhelpful responses.

My current favourite earplugs

I was skeptical about these earplugs, the SNR rating of 25 seems pretty high, with most other concert earplugs going to around 19-21, and as you can probably see a lot of the reviews on Trustpilot seem to be unhappy(ears) with these earplugs.

I was pleasantly surprised, having tried both Senner and Apline earplugs, these are the only earplugs that successfully lower large night clubs (printworks, ministry of sound) to a pleasant volume. At first it can seem like they lower the sound too much, but after a couple hours you'll be thankful they do.

As for fit, these are the least compliant earplugs I've used, and I had my reseverations because I've often had trouble with earplugs either staying in my right ear, or going too far into either ear and being hard to retrieve.

However I am happy to report that I haven't had any issues with these going too far into my ears, and while they may not be the height of comfort, they have a much more consistent fit and require less fiddling with throughout the night, allowing me to forget that they're there to begin with.

As for some help on sizing, myself and a few friends have all picked these up for clubbing, and so far all four of us have come out as a large.

Great at sound reduction, but too uncomfortable for sleep

Unlike other reviewers I found a size that fit perfectly from the trial pack (large) and I found that they were excellent at blocking out noise at night (snoring, street sounds etc) - much better than disposable types I've tried, and best sleep I've had in months. But they are ultimately uncomfortable to wear repeatedly if sleeping on your side - the hard plastic centre really hurts my ears and so after about 2 weeks of use I am having to look for an alternative product as it's just too painful to continue use. Shame, because if comfort were better I would be keeping these for life.
